英文摘要 | With the purpose of assessing the status of dormancy in seeds of two Begonia species (Begonia lithophila and Begonia guishanensis), freshly matured seeds were given gibberellic acid and moist chilling and allowed to dry after ripening. The seeds were then germinated on media with or without KNO3 at 15, 20, 25, 30 and 18/25 degrees C. All three treatments significantly increased germination percentages. Examination by X-ray revealed that seeds of both species have a fully developed embryo and thus have no morphological component of dormancy; seeds readily imbibed water and KNO3 solution. Therefore, we conclude that seeds of the two Begonia species have non-deep physiological dormancy. Although KNO3 significantly increased germination in both species, alternating temperatures did not, suggesting that the most favorable microhabitat for germination is small-scale disturbances under the forest canopy. |
